Valenciaport records increase in exports in October

Export container traffic at Valenciaport during October showed an increase of approximately 11.7% compared to the same period last year.

In October, a total of 492,772 containers were handled by Valencian terminals, of which 85,961 contained cargo destined for export.

The Statistical Office of the Port Authority of Valencia recorded that traffic at its headquarters in Valencia, Sagunto, and Gandia amounted to 6,128,740 tonnes during October, representing a decrease of just over one point (1.25%) compared to the previous month. In contrast, traffic recorded in TEUs grew by 4.46%, as shown by the above figures.

In cumulative terms, Valenciaport has handled a total of 67,171,486 tonnes of goods so far this year, reflecting a slight decrease compared to 2024 (-1.12%).

Container traffic, however, rose to 4,779,759 units, 3.74% more than the previous year.

From a year-on-year perspective examining traffic over the last 12 months Valenciaport has handled 79,903,482 tonnes (-0.85%), and in terms of containerized goods, Valencian terminals have moved 5,647,910 TEUs over the last year (+4.47%).

China leads Valenciaport’s foreign trade for yet another month, with 7,448,835 tonnes (+12.57%) and 702,248 TEUs (+18.94%). In terms of tonnes, Italy ranks second with 5,680,488 tonnes, although the volume of goods traded with this country has fallen by 2.3%.

The United States is the second most important destination in terms of TEUs, with 314,955 containers (+1.22%), followed by Algeria with 269,423 (+32.64%).
